PET INSURANCE: Worth the Cost?

I’m sure many of you have contemplated getting pet insurance for

your canine companions. The number of pet insurance companies out

there has ballooned in the last few years, and exploring their various

policies, exclusions, deductibles and payouts gets bewildering. Here

are two articles that can help cut down on your research. The first one

is most recent, a 2015 article in The Canine Journal:

http://www.caninejournal.com/pet-insurance-comparison/#winner

The second one is older, a Seattle Times series written in 2012, but it

gives a more extensive breakdown of each company. Note that both

articles end up recommending similar companies:

AKC Tracking Judges’ Seminar

Sunday, May 31, 2015 Family Dog Training Center

1515 Central Ave S. Kent, WA

A rare opportunity in the Pacific Northwest. An AKC tracking judges’ seminar, with AKC presenter, Diane Schultz, Senior Executive Field Representative. This is a must for tracking judges and prospective judges in fulfilling AKC requirements. It is open to all interested in and/or involved in tracking. Learn about the rules, regulations, club requirements and those pesky situations that sometimes show up at a test. This is not a training session in learning how to track and does not involve dogs. It will be from 8:30AM to around 5PM. There will 2 breaks and lunch provided. The fee is $60 if postmarked by 5/1/15 and $90 after. (50% refund 5/1/15-5/10/15) From I-5.
